The contract involves the secure and timely transportation of temperature-sensitive medical products to a Department of Defense facility under FOB Destination terms, ensuring the responsibility and risk remain with the carrier until delivery is completed at the specified destination. All shipments must utilize the fastest traceable means available to guarantee product integrity, regulatory compliance, and real-time visibility throughout transit, with strict adherence to the specialized handling requirements inherent to medical temperature-controlled logistics. The work falls under NAICS code 484220, classifying it as specialized freight trucking, and is structured as a subcontract issued by the Defense Logistics Agency under the broader authority of the Department of Defense. The agreement mandates full accountability from origin through final delivery, with no tolerance for delays or deviations that could compromise the efficacy or safety of the medical payloads. While the exact location of performance is not specified, the contractual obligations require compliance with DoD logistics protocols and documentation standards appropriate for defense-related medical supply chains.
